Dr. Mohammadisiahroudi Mohammadhossein, Department of Mathematics and Statistics

This project focuses on implementing and benchmarking quantum algorithms for solving large-scale optimization and linear algebra problems arising in applications such as artificial intelligence and machine learning. These tasks require substantial computational resources to simulate quantum circuits, evaluate performance across different problem instances, and compare quantum-inspired methods with state-of-the-art classical algorithms. Access to the university’s HPC cluster will enable efficient execution of quantum circuit simulations, large-dimensional linear algebra routines, and optimization benchmarks, supporting the development and evaluation of scalable quantum algorithms for real-world applications.
